Ramo Legenda: The Finnish Hip-Hop Pioneer

Ramo Legenda is a foundational Finnish rapper and songwriter from Helsinki. He is widely recognized as one of the key architects of the Finnish hip-hop scene, achieving significant commercial success and critical acclaim throughout his career.

Early career

Born in 1981, Ramo Legenda began his musical journey in the late 1990s within Helsinki's burgeoning rap community. His early work was characterized by raw, street-level storytelling, leading to his debut album "Rakkaudesta" in 2003, which established his distinctive, gravelly vocal style and narrative focus.

Breakthrough

His major breakthrough arrived in 2005 with the album "Rakkaudesta 2", released on the influential Finnish label Monsp Records. The album resonated powerfully, achieving gold certification in Finland and spawning several hit singles that dominated domestic radio and music video channels, cementing his status as a mainstream force.

Key tracks

Rakkaudesta — This title track from his breakthrough album became an anthem, showcasing his signature blend of emotional depth and streetwise realism.

Kuka mä oon — A deeply personal and introspective track that connected with a wide audience and became a staple of his live performances.

Kun mä tuun — Known for its catchy hook and confident delivery, this track further solidified his radio presence and commercial appeal.

Rakkauden haudalla — A later career highlight that demonstrated his evolving songwriting and continued relevance within the Finnish music industry.

Following his breakthrough, Ramo Legenda continued to release successful albums, including "Rakkaudesta 3" in 2007 and "Rakkaudesta 4" in 2010, often collaborating with other major Finnish artists like Cheek and Uniikki. His consistent output and authentic persona have maintained his position as a respected veteran in the genre.
